Instructions

14 steps
  1. 1

    To begin making Chow Chow Milagu Kootu Recipe, wash and peel the outer skin of the chayote quash with a peeler

    chow chow (chayote squash) - cut into cubes(2)
  2. 2

    Cut it into cubes and keep aside

    chow chow (chayote squash) - cut into cubes(2)
  3. 3

    Wash and soak the moong dal in water for 10 minutes

    yellow moong dal (split)(1/2 cup)
  4. 4

    In a small pan, dry roast the peppercorns, cumin seeds, urad dal and grated coconut till they turn golden and fragrant in medium heat

    mustard seeds(1 teaspoon)whole black peppercorns(1 teaspoon)cumin seeds (jeera)(1 teaspoon)teaspoons white urad dal (split)(2)fresh coconut - grated(1 tablespoon)
  5. 5

    Grind it to a coarse mix using a mixer grinder and keep aside

  6. 6

    Heat oil in a pressure cooker, add the mustard seeds, let it crackle

    mustard seeds(1 teaspoon)cumin seeds (jeera)(1 teaspoon)
  7. 7

    Once the mustard seeds have crackled add the asafoetida, curry leaves, red chillies and let it splutter

    mustard seeds(1 teaspoon)sprig curry leaves(1)dry red chillies(2)asafoetida (hing) - a pinchcumin seeds (jeera)(1 teaspoon)
  8. 8

    Add the chayote squash and saute for a minute

  9. 9

    Drain and add the moong dal, and saute for a minute

    yellow moong dal (split)(1/2 cup)
  10. 10

    Add the ground pepper mix, turmeric powder, salt to taste, 1

    turmeric powder (haldi)(1/2 teaspoon)salt - to taste
  11. 11

    5 cup of water and mix well

  12. 12

    Put the lid on and pressure cook for 2 whistles on medium heat

  13. 13

    Once the pressure is completely released, remove the lid, mix well and its ready to serve

  14. 14

    Serve the Chow Chow Milagu Kootu Recipe along with Phulkas or with Jeera Rasam, Steamed Rice and Elai Vadam for the weeknight dinner

    chow chow (chayote squash) - cut into cubes(2)
